Rain gutters are an integral part of a residence's drain system. Throughout a rainstorm, roof gutters pilot drainage from a huge surface area-- a house's roof-- to where it can drain away from your house. By doing so, they safeguard exterior siding, windows, doors, and also foundations from water damages and help prevent flooding in cellars.

Even if the rain gutter does not overflow, water merging in the rain gutter, incorporated with a large amount of leaves will develop into a problem as well. The leaves, sticks and other organic product will break down and also incorporate with the typical asphalt granules that escape of a common household roof. This mix creates a rough, mud-like sludge that lines the rain gutters as well as downspouts. This sludge after that functions its way right into downspouts as well as drains pipes, totally blocking any additional water passage. Commonly, the only method to settle such clog is to dig up the drain and change it.
